di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/sgd,gktw70sdae4se.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/sgd,gktw70sdae4se.yaml
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..487283288cb0
--- /dev/null
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/display/panel/sgd,gktw70sdae4se.yaml
@@ -0,0 +1,63 @@
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
+%YAML 1.2
+---
+$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/display/panel/sgd,gktw70sdae4se.yaml#
+$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
+
+title: Solomon Goldentek Display GKTW70SDAE4SE 7" WVGA LVDS Display Panel
+
+maintainers:
+ - Neil Armstrong <narmstrong@baylibre.com>
+ - Thierry Reding <thierry.reding@gmail.com>
+
+allOf:
+ - $ref: lvds.yaml#
+
+properties:
+ compatible:
+ items:
+ - const: sgd,gktw70sdae4se
+ - {} # panel-lvds, but not listed here to avoid false select
+
+ data-mapping:
+ const: jeida-18
+
+ width-mm:
+ const: 153
+
+ height-mm:
+ const: 86
+
+required:
+ - compatible
+
+examples:
+ - |+
+ panel {
+ compatible = "sgd,gktw70sdae4se", "panel-lvds";
+
+ width-mm = <153>;
+ height-mm = <86>;
+
+ data-mapping = "jeida-18";
+
+ panel-timing {
+ clock-frequency = <32000000>;
+ hactive = <800>;
+ vactive = <480>;
+ hback-porch = <39>;
+ hfront-porch = <39>;
+ vback-porch = <29>;
+ vfront-porch = <13>;
+ hsync-len = <47>;
+ vsync-len = <2>;
+ };
+
+ port {
+ panel_in: endpoint {
+ remote-endpoint = <&lvds_encoder>;
+ };
+ };
+ };
+
+...
